How To Choose The Best Affordable Hair Mask
Selecting the right mask isn’t about grabbing the cheapest jar. It’s about matching a formula’s core action to your hair’s specific needs. Focus on these elements to make an informed choice that delivers visible results.
Identify Your Primary Hair Concern
Are your strands brittle and snapping, or are they porous and frizzy? Hair that breaks easily often needs protein to reinforce its structure, while dry, fluffy hair craves deep moisture. Many affordable masks specialize in one area, so pinpointing your main issue is the first step to success.
Understand the Ingredient Heroes
Look for specific active ingredients rather than vague claims. For protein repair, seek out hydrolyzed keratin, collagen, or flax protein. For intense hydration, argan oil, shea butter, and honey are powerhouses. Avoid formulas loaded with cheap silicones that merely coat the hair without providing lasting nourishment.
Consider Your Hair Texture and Porosity
Fine hair can be weighed down by heavy, buttery masks, while thick, coarse hair might drink up the same formula. Low-porosity hair benefits from lighter, heat-activated treatments, whereas high-porosity hair needs richer, sealing ingredients. The best affordable mask for you will complement your hair’s natural behavior.

Understanding the Specs
Protein vs. Moisture
This is the most critical distinction. Protein treatments (with keratin, collagen, flax protein) are for hair that is gummy when wet, stretches, and breaks easily—they reinforce the internal structure. Moisturizing masks (with oils, butters, honey) are for hair that is dry, frizzy, and porous—they hydrate and seal the cuticle. Using the wrong type can lead to brittleness or limpness.
Key Active Ingredients
Look for specific, proven ingredients. Hydrolyzed proteins can penetrate the hair shaft. Natural oils like argan and shea butter are excellent emollients. Humectants like honey and glycerin draw in moisture. Ceramides help seal and protect the hair cuticle. Avoid formulas where dimethicone is a top ingredient if you seek true nourishment over coating.
Application Time & Heat
For a deep treatment, 5-10 minutes is often sufficient for mid-range masks. For severe damage, 20-30 minutes with heat (a shower cap or hot towel) can dramatically increase penetration. Some professional formulas are designed to work in as little as 3-5 minutes without heat. Always follow the product’s specific instructions for best results.
Hair Type Considerations
Fine, low-porosity hair needs lightweight, liquid-based proteins and avoid heavy butters at the roots. Thick, high-porosity, or curly hair can handle and often craves rich, creamy masks with shea butter and oils. Color-treated hair benefits from sulfate-free, gentle formulas to preserve color while providing moisture.
